Napoli Pizza
One More Time
Show More

Storefronts & Signs

Brands needs to stand out to capture passing foot traffic and give their customers a great feeling as they walk in.  During his design career, Rod worked with Dio Yang designs, an architectural firm, which specializes in malls and created signage and designs for the in-store experience.   


Rod’s designs bring life to your retail space and give your customers a great brand experience as they visit your store.


Contact Rod today to learn more!

© 2023 by Sasha Blake. Proudly created with